首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在python中获取字典中最大值的键

在Python中获取字典中最大值的键可以通过以下步骤完成:

  1. 首先,我们需要获取字典中的所有值,可以使用字典的values()方法来实现。将这些值存储在一个列表中。
  2. 接下来,我们可以使用Python内置的max()函数来获取列表中的最大值。max()函数会返回列表中的最大值。
  3. 然后,我们可以使用字典的items()方法来获取字典中的键值对。将这些键值对存储在一个列表中。
  4. 最后,我们可以遍历这个键值对列表,找到对应最大值的键,并将其返回。

以下是一个示例代码:

代码语言:txt
复制
def get_max_key(dictionary):
    values = list(dictionary.values())  # 获取字典中的所有值
    max_value = max(values)  # 获取最大值
    key_value_pairs = list(dictionary.items())  # 获取字典中的键值对
    
    for key, value in key_value_pairs:
        if value == max_value:
            return key

# 示例字典
my_dict = {'a': 10, 'b': 5, 'c': 20, 'd': 15}

# 调用函数获取最大值的键
max_key = get_max_key(my_dict)

print("字典中最大值的键为:", max_key)

上述代码将输出:

代码语言:txt
复制
字典中最大值的键为: c

推荐的腾讯云相关产品:在云计算领域,腾讯云提供了强大的计算资源和解决方案,您可以考虑使用腾讯云的云服务器CVM进行应用部署和运维。您可以了解更多关于腾讯云云服务器CVM的信息和产品介绍,请点击这里

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券